Morning wood sex involves physiological responses during rapid eye movement sleep, characterized by spontaneous erections. This phenomenon, termed nocturnal penile tumescence, occurs without conscious arousal. During this time, the erectile tissue in the penis fills with blood, engorging the organ. No direct connection exists between this and a partner’s presence. Studies highlight that factors such as hormonal shifts and sleep patterns significantly influence these occurrences. For those facing erectile dysfunction, the ICD-10 code is N52.9, addressing diagnosis. Researchers often analyze morning erections as indicators of physical health, noting that patterns can shift over time.
